Approved Non-CS Courses M.S. students in the Computer Science general program can only take up to ONE (3-4 unit) course from approved EE, DSCI (formerly INF), MATH, DSO, or ISE courses. This policy still applies even if the course is cross-listed to the CSCI prefix from another academic unit.

Why do I have to take a written course in CS?

The purpose of this requirement is to ensure that students have at least one course that synthesizes and integrates skills and knowledge acquired throughout the CS undergraduate curriculum, and which includes a significant design experience, where teamwork and written and oral communication are a key part of that design experience.

What is not CS?

The :not() CSS pseudo-class represents elements that do not match a list of selectors. Since it prevents specific items from being selected, it is known as the negation pseudo-class. /* Selects any element that is NOT a paragraph */ :not(p) { color: blue; }

Can non CS students work at Google?

Do I need a computer science degree to be a Google software engineer? No, a CS degree isn't required for most of our software engineering or product manager roles.

How hard is a CS degree?

CS has earned a reputation as a challenging major. And earning a degree in computer science does test students. Majors need strong technical skills, the ability to learn multiple programming languages, and exceptional analytical and problem-solving abilities.

What is CS course?

CS Course in the commerce domain is one of the most popular choices amongst commerce students. However, students of all fields can apply to this course. Institute of Company Secretaries of India offers Company Secretary Course. It is a distance learning course that began to regulate the Company Secretary Profession.

How long is CS course?

CS Course Duration. CS Foundation Course Duration is around 8 months and when it comes to CS Executive Course the duration is of 9 months. However, CS Professional course duration is for 10 months. The course should be completed within a span of 3 years from the period of admission. Training for CS Course.
